
The New York Police Department noticed a 14 percent drop in black officers since 2008. The total dropped from 4,162 to 3,598 this September. Similar declines have taken place in Los Angeles, Philadelphia and Chicago.

In the 14 months since, the Burlington Police Department has dropped from around 90 officers, when the resolution was passed, to under 70 today. This is largely thanks, officials say, to cops leaving for higher-paying jobs in other departments or retiring earlier than expected.

The 35-year-old has been on the run since Friday, Sept. 24, after he was named as the suspect who shot Deputy Joshua Moyers twice, including once in the back, during a traffic stop in Callahan, FL. Moyers died of his injuries two days later.
